这篇文章主要介绍了PHP向浏览器输出内容的4个函数总结,本文总结的就是print()、echo()、printf()、sprintf()这4个输出函数,需要的朋友可以参考下

/*

* 0x01:print()语句

* int print(arguments);

* print()语句把传入它的数据输出到浏览器

*/

print("

I love PHP!!!

");

print "

I love PHP!!!

";

?>

/*

* 0x02:echo()语句,功能和print()函数的功能一样

* 都是将数据输出到浏览器

* echo()函数执行输出的效率比print()函数的效率稍微好一点,因为echo不返回结果

*/

echo "

I love PHP!!!

";

$languge="Java";

echo "

I love $languge!!!

";

?>

/*

* 0x03:printf()语句

* 如果你想输出由任何静态文本和一个或多个变量中存储的动态信息组成的混合产物,使用printf()函数比较理想

* printf()函数将静态数据和动态数据分为两个部分,其形式如下:

* integer printf(string format [,mixed args]);

*/

printf("

I love %s!!!

","C#");

/*

* 上面例子中%s是一个占位符,下面列出常用的占位符

* 类型          描述

* %b      将参数认为是一个整数,显示为二进制数

* %c      将参数认为是一个整数,显示为对应的ASCII字符

* %d      将参数认为是一个整数,显示为有符号的十进制数

* %f      将参数认为是一个浮点数,显示为浮点数

* %o      将参数认为是一个整数,显示为八进制数

* %s      将参数认为是字符串,显示为字符串

* %u      将参数认为是一个整数,显示为无符号整数

* %x      将参数认为是一个整数,显示为小写的16进制数

* %X      将参数认为是一个整数,显示为大写的16进制数

*/

$num=1024;

printf("

%b:%c:%d:%f:%o:%s:%u:%x:%X

",$num,$num,$num,$num,$num,$num,$num,$num,$num);

?>

/*

* 0x04:sprintf()语句

* sprintf()函数于printf函数的功能一样,不过它是将输出的值赋给一个字符串,而不是直接输出到浏览器

* 这个函数很有用,比如格式化含有动态输出的字符串,结合上面的占位符,还可以作进制转换,其形式为:

* string sprintf(string format [, mixed args]);

*/

$cost=sprintf("$%.2f",43.2);//$cost=$43.20

?>

php 输出函数结果,PHP向浏览器输出内容的4个函数总结相关推荐

  1. python中用于输出内容到终端的函数是_python执行linux shell管道输出内容

    jquery选择器(三)-过滤选择器 一.基本过滤选择器 二.内容过滤选择器 1. 包含文本内容为"text"的元素 2. 含有某个选择器所匹配的父元素 3. 包含有子元素或者文本 ...

  2. php nginx立即输出内容

    //配合ob_flush();flush();立即向浏览器输出内容 header('X-Accel-Buffering: no'); //立即输出到浏览器 ob_flush(); flush();

  3. html控制台 打印 consol,浏览器console.log()打印输出台不显示输出内容……

    浏览器console.log()打印输出台不显示输出内容的原因应该很多,如网络上所说:console.log()被重新定义等等原因(需要验证真实性?)都可能导致console.log()打印不能显示打 ...

  4. php输出网络连接,如何打开php文件和输出内容

    php是什么文件?php文件如何打开?如何输出php内容?我们经常会遇到一些以php格式.php结尾的文件,对于不认识这种文件是什么,又不知道怎么打开php文件,下面网络自学网就来详细介绍什么php文 ...

  5. php内容缓存输出,PHP使用缓存即时输出内容(output buffering)的方法

    PHP使用缓存即时输出内容(output buffering)的方法 PHP使用缓存即时输出内容(output buffering)的方法.分享给大家供大家参考.具体如下: $buffer = ini ...

  6. JavaScript知识笔记(一)——入门、语句、注释、变量、函数、输出内容、对话框、窗口

    JavaScript可以提供漂亮的网页.令用户满意的上网体验. 1.增强页面动态效果(如:下拉菜单.图片轮播.信息滚动等) 2.实现页面与用户之间的实时.动态交互(如:用户注册.登陆验证等) 引用Ja ...

  7. ncurses输出函数:字符+字符串的输出

    Copyright(C) NCURSES Programming HOWTO 输出函数 在curses 函数中有三类输出函数,它们分别是: addch()系列:将单一的字符打印到屏幕上,可以附加加字符 ...

  8. gprof 输出内容解释

    gprof输出内容示例 Each sample counts as 0.01 seconds .% cumulative self self total time seconds seconds ca ...

  9. php输出内容到页面,php实时输出内容

    实时输出如果放在js中我们可以直接使用settimeout来守时输入很方便,但是如果在php中实现起来就不能这样了,下面我来给介绍利用 ob_flush() 和 flush()函数实现即时实时输出内容 ...

最新文章

  1. Android log打印不出来
  2. Java并发编程原理与实战一:聊聊并发
  3. Java 基础【08】.class getClass () forName() 详解
  4. hdu1032 Train Problem II (卡特兰数)
  5. STM32关于BOOT0和BOOT1设置,去掉Debug后完成硬件独立运行。
  6. (9)跨段跳转,短调用和长调用堆栈图
  7. 中间人攻击-http流量嗅探
  8. C# - DynamicObject with Dynamic
  9. 不要错过这轮疫情的“洗牌”机会
  10. .NetCore Cap 结合 RabbitMQ 实现消息订阅
  11. Android File.listFiles()返回null问题
  12. android 增加触摸范围,android seekBar 增加点击和滑动范围
  13. Oracle 安装时候的fs.aio-max-nr参数
  14. kali linux工具pyrit,在Kali Linux上安装cuda、pyritcuda以及optimus -电脑资料
  15. 数字图像处理(一)——彩色图像基础
  16. python包管理(pip, 源码)
  17. 常见的HTTP状态码说明
  18. Qt之QThread基本用法
  19. linux常用命令大全,建议收藏
  20. QT QProcess 使用及实时输出回显

热门文章

  1. CmsEasy20160825前台无限制GetShell复现
  2. MYSQL外键(Foreign Key)的使用
  3. 理清fineuploader无刷新上传的一些事
  4. Knockout应用开发指南(完整版) 目录索引
  5. mysql 游标 ,嵌套游标
  6. 自由的胜利:多元化智能平台BCH
  7. 机器学习算法如何调参?这里有一份神经网络学习速率设置指南
  8. 【Django】@login_required用法简介
  9. php之cookie
  10. 【原创】HP 安装 depot (以mysql为例)